Aspen: Improvements for 2005/06 season

Village Express Lift
The existing Fanny Hill chairlift will be replaced with a six-passenger lift named Village Express. A speedy 9.5-minute ride gets you from the bottom of Fanny Hill to the top of Sam's Knob, with a mid-way unloading station for those wishing to access beginner terrain. Village Express accommodates 2,800 people per hour, is 10,057 feet long and has 2,174 vertical feet of rise.

Mall Connector
A fast and fun aerial connection between existing Snowmass Village Mall and new Base Village connects commercial centers and integrates conference activities. This two-minute ride (think of it as an elevator on cables between two retail centers) provides uphill or downhill connectivity to a one-of-a-kind Snowmass Village complex. Cabins are six-passenger. The Mall Connector offers lower Fanny Hill skiing and snowboarding access for children's learn-to-ski/snowboard programs.

Existing Lifts to be Modified/Removed
Fanny Hill - removed and replaced with Village Express chairlift (Summer 2005)
Wood Run Triple Chair - removed (Summer 2005)
Burlingame - rebuilt and shortened (Summer 2005)
